North Ayrshire Primary Teachers CPD- 22 Primary teachers from 12 schools in North Ayrshire attended a 2-hour CPD session at St Winning's Primary School on 20th May. The session covered content from BADMINTONscotland's Primary Curriculum for Excellence Pack including; warm-up games, practices to develop grips and serving skills as well as many fun on-court games. Each attending school received a resource pack and 1 year's affiliation, funded through North Ayrshire Active Schools. It is hoped that attendees will now start to deliver badminton as part of the curricular PE as well as in lunch-time and after-school badminton clubs.
Glasgow Primary Teachers CPD- 16 Primary teachers from the East End of Glasgow attended a 2-hour session covering BADMINTONscotland's Primary Curriculum for Excellence Pack. The training is one part of a partnership project between BADMINTONscotland, Glasgow Active Schools and Glasgow Sport; offering schools in Glasgow's Clyde Gateway Badminton Coaching, Resources, Equipment as well as training for Teaching Staff.
